They'll never go back because they almost went broke a decade and a bit ago, it was the ultimate fighter reality TV show that saved them.
The ultimate fighter brought them mainstream viewers as all their stuff before hand was only ppv. I also remember the final match between Forrest Griffin and Stephan Bonnar was absolutely crazy. People who hadn't seen the UFC before that it was nuts.

@Mr Invisible the thing about egos their have always been guys with egos throughout the ufc. Tito Ortiz was one of the first big trash talkers in the organization. There are always going to be egos and trash talking it all part of it. 90% of the fighters would be respected and respectful of their opposition, and usually when there is a bit of trash talking involved before hand it is normally squashed after the fight is done.

Though there are times where fighters a legit hate for one another, which can be ego driven.
